Under 300 is low thats what most doctors will tell u, between 600-800 would be ideal to some people, I'm talking TRT levels, while some others want to be 1200-1500. But remember the higher the levels the more sides you will be getting like E2, hemocrit/hemoglobin. I was 198 when I first got tested. I would recommend u to read, read and read about the options you have, like if u want HCG, Aromasin-Arimedex, etc. the more informed you are the better.
